High Tasks Freezes Server Every Few Days

Featured Replies

Hello wizards of unraid, I need some help with my server

Every few days for a couple weeks now, I will notice that I lost connection to every docker containers that I ran in the server. When I ssh into it, the htop is always like this

I can still open the webui, but everytime I want to get the diagnostic it will always hang for hours like this:

When I try to stop the container by cli, it will always fail for containers that have remote (NFS, from a synology nas) path mapped

And when I try to restart docker with /etc/rc.d/rc.docker restart it will worsen the situation, the process will stuck and I cant do anything with cli anymore

I thought it was because of file mover, so I changed it to weekly but it still happening before a week pass by
I thought it was because of Jellyfin and Plex transcoding or something so I turned them off and move them to another server but it still happening

The only fix I know as of now is hard reset, it will not restart if I do it from cli (it will if I do it before this happen)

The server setup:
- 1 SSD as pool for docker and container app data
- 1 HDD as arrays and 3 NFS from NAS for whatever other data that I need to feed to the containers


I'm out of idea here. Thank you for the help and sorry if my english is hard to understand
